D9G (p.Asp9Gly) variant of CASP8 (Caspase-8)
D9G (p.Asp9Gly) in CASP8 (Caspase-8)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as uncertain significance in the context of Autoimmune lymphoproliferative syndrome type 2B.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.11 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data and structural context.
